    Program-specific prompts

    These apply only if you are applying to the named program or school.

    • Architecture, Architectural Studies, and Music IndustryRequired500 words max

      Why this field

      Reflect on your experiences, personal characteristics, and unique traits that have prepared you for the challenges and opportunities associated with your chosen major. How have these things shaped your goals, aspirations, and potential contributions to your field of study?

      How to approach it

      This is a why-us prompt. The trap is describing the school back to itself; rankings and campus beauty read as filler. Name the two or three specific things (a program, a professor's work, a structure like open curriculum) you would actually use, and tie each to something you have already done.

    • BA/BS+MD Early Assurance ProgramRequired500 words max

      Why Drexel Medicine

      Tell the Admission Committee why you are applying to the joint program with the Drexel University College of Medicine. Be sure to explain why you want to be a physician and, more specifically, why you want to obtain your medical education at the Drexel University College of Medicine.

    Common questions

    Drexel University essays, answered

    How many essays does Drexel University require?

    Drexel University lists 2 writing supplements for the 2026–27 cycle, all required. That is on top of the main personal statement.

    How long are the Drexel University supplemental essays?

    Word limits across the listed prompts add up to roughly 1,000 words. Budget real time for them: supplements are where admissions sees your specific interest in Drexel University.

    Do the Drexel University supplemental essays matter?

    Yes, and more as selectivity rises. Grades and scores put you in the pool; supplements are one of the few places you control what the reader learns about you, and a generic why-us essay is one of the most common self-inflicted wounds in admissions.
